Warning Signs You Need Shower Pan Leak Water Removal

Ignoring the signs of a shower pan leak can lead to catastrophic consequences. It’s essential to be aware of the warning signs and take action quickly. Our team is here to help you identify the issue and provide a solution before it’s too late.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ice a musty smell in your shower area, it’s crucial to investigate the source and address it quickly.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Discoloration on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any water stains, it’s essential to investigate the source and take action to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any issues with your flooring, it’s crucial to address the problem quickly to prevent further damage.

Increased Water Bills

Unusually high water bills can show a hidden leak. If you notice a sudden increase in your water bills, it’s essential to investigate the source and address the issue quickly.

Visible Signs of Water Damage

Visible signs of water damage, such as peeling paint or warping wood, can show a serious issue. If you notice any signs of water damage, it’s crucial to address the problem quickly to prevent further damage.

Common Questions About Shower Pan Leak Water Removal

Q: What causes a shower pan leak?

A: A shower pan leak can be caused by a variety of factors, including worn-out caulk, cracked tiles, or improper installation. Our team will assess the issue and provide a solution to prevent future leaks.
